When you're in a relegation battle, you have to win at all costs. In West Ham's case, the cost of Sunday's victory over Southampton was the sheer lack of optimism the performance gave the fanbase that it will be the game to spark a recovery. We simply had to beat Southampton to avoid slipping to the bottom of the table, instead climbing as high as 14th and a point above the bottom three. But the performance wasn't exactly mind-blowing. If anything, it was mind-numbing. But the three points are all that matter as we attempt to avoid the drop. Now we face two very difficult Premier League games in the space of a few days; first up is the visit of Newcastle in Stratford on Wednesday night before we travel to west London to take on Fulham at Craven Cottage on Saturday afternoon. Joining us this week to preview both games is The Sun's Head of Sport and huge Newcastle fan, Shaun Custis, and Dom Betts from the Fulhamish Podcast. Also this week, James and Will give their thoughts on the win over Southampton and also spend time debating the hot topic of the infamous 3pm blackout rule.
